
The New Vision
One of the most important schools for architecture, design, and art in the 20th century, the Weimar Bauhaus included in its distinguished membership Moholy-Nagy. This book, a valuable introduction to the Bauhaus movement, is generously illustrated with examples of students' experiments and typical contemporary achievements. The text also contains an autobiographical sketch.
Reprint of The New Vision: Fundamentals of Design, Painting, Sculpture, Architecture, W. W. Norton & Company, Inc., New York, 1938. "Abstract of an Artist" excerpted from the George Wittenborn, Inc., New York, 1947 editoin.
